As part of its mandate to support the implementation of gender equality principles in activities related to Roma and Sinti, ODIHR is organizing a consultation meeting with Roma and Sinti women, experts and civil society representatives from the OSCE region in Warsaw on 23 and 24 November 2022.
The meeting will provide space to discuss the current situation of Roma and Sinti women in view of gender equality and women’s issues. This includes mapping out specific challenges Roma and Sinti women face on their way towards full participation in all areas of public and political life, as well as their needs related to empowerment and capacity building. The meeting will also inform participants about ODIHR’s ongoing work related to gender equality, including on policies, institutions, women’s participation in politics and electoral processes, gender-based violence, trafficking in human beings and other relevant areas.
Recognizing the multiple forms of discrimination affecting Roma and Sinti women in the OSCE area, ODIHR is specifically tasked with preventing, promoting and implementing the principles of gender equality and combating discrimination and inequalities that limit the enjoyment of fundamental rights by Roma and Sinti women.
